The MSMCJ64CA operates by diverting excess current away from sensitive components when a transient voltage spike occurs. It acts as a shunt to protect the circuitry from overvoltage events.
The MSMCJ64CA is commonly used in various electronic devices and systems, including: - Power supplies - Telecommunication equipment - Automotive electronics - Industrial control systems
